Synthesizing: Attributes of Unchosen Alternatives in a Mode Choice Model Using an Agent-Based Model and Web-Based Multimodal Trip Planners

Abstract:

The paper aims to investigate the application of agent-based simulation and web-based routing applications in synthesizing the attributes of unchosen alternatives in a mode choice model. Revealed preference data usually contains rich information on travelers’ real-world constraints and preferences. However, it often lacks information on unchosen alternatives which prevents researchers to take a full advantage of the data. This work addresses this problem by using simulation and web-based routing applications to synthesize the missing information. The synthesized data are compared with household travel survey data, and are used to estimate a series of mode choice models. The implied values of travel time are also reported and compared. The results demonstrate high correlation between the synthesized and real-world data. The estimated value of travel time is shown to be aligned with the previous studies for commuters and non-commuters. Overall, the paper demonstrates the applicability of synthesized data in estimating the attributes of unchosen alternatives in travel behavior studies and the sensitivity of the implied value of travel time to the data sources used in estimating missing information.
